• 제목/요약/키워드: Video on demand

검색결과 519건 처리시간 0.038초

가변 비트율 주문형 비디오 서버에서 선반입자 캐슁을 이용한 버퍼 관리 기법 (A Buffer Management Scheme Using Prefetching and Caching for Variable Bit Rate Video-On-Demand Servers)

  • 김순철
    • 한국산업정보학회논문지
    • /
    • 제4권4호
    • /
    • pp.32-39
    • /
    • 1999
  • 주문형 비디오 시스템에서 가변 비트율로 압축된 데이타들은 압축 대상이 되는 데이타의 내용 변화와 압축 기법의 특성으로 인해 단위 시간 당 처리해야 할 데이타 크기가 일정하지 않다. 그러나, 대부분의 주문형 비디오 서버들은 가변 비트율로 압축된 데이타를 실시간에 처리하기 위해 가변 데이타 크기의 최대값으로 시스템 자원을 예약하기 때문에 자원의 활용률이 떨어진다. 본 논문에서는 주문형 비디오 서버에서 시스템 자원의 활용률을 향상시켜 더 많은 사용자를 수용할 수 있는 버퍼 관리 기법을 제안한다. 제안된 버퍼 관리 기법은 데이타에 대한 캐슁 기법과 함께 가변 비트율로 압축된 데이타를 예약할 때 선반입 기법을 적용함으로써 비디오 데이타의 가변성을 줄이고 디스크 대역폭과 서버 버퍼에 대한 활용률을 극대화하였다. 본 논문에서 제안한 버퍼 관리 기법의 효율성은 모의 실험을 통해 확인하였다.

  • PDF

Video on Demand 서비스를 위한 MPEG-4 시스템 구현 (Implementation of MPEG-4 System for Video on Demand Services)

  • 최승철;김남규;최석림
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 2001년도 하계종합학술대회 논문집(1)
    • /
    • pp.225-228
    • /
    • 2001
  • We describe the implementation of MPEG-4 Systems for Video on Demand services. We discuss the issues in implementint MPEG-4 Systems, specially Object Description and Elementary stream management(Buffer control, Synchronization). The file-server pump the multiplexed streams to the client through the DMIF. Interaction between server and client is done with User Command(play, pause, stop, fast foward, ...). Stream data are multiplexed off-line. In advance, the file-server read multiplexed streams and pumps it to MPEG-4 terminal(client). Our system can be used in various application not only Video on Demand services, but also Internet broadcasting, remote surveillance, mobile communication, remote education, etc.

  • PDF

Improving the Availability of Scalable on-demand Streams by Dynamic Buffering on P2P Networks

  • Lin, Chow-Sing
    • KSII Transactions on Internet and Information Systems (TIIS)
    • /
    • 제4권4호
    • /
    • pp.491-508
    • /
    • 2010
  • In peer-to-peer (P2P) on-demand streaming networks, the alleviation of server load depends on reciprocal stream sharing among peers. In general, on-demand video services enable clients to watch videos from beginning to end. As long as clients are able to buffer the initial part of the video they are watching, on-demand service can provide access to the video to the next clients who request to watch it. Therefore, the key challenge is how to keep the initial part of a video in a peer's buffer for as long as possible, and thus maximize the availability of a video for stream relay. In addition, to address the issues of delivering data on lossy network and providing scalable quality of services for clients, the adoption of multiple description coding (MDC) has been proven as a feasible resolution by much research work. In this paper, we propose a novel caching scheme for P2P on-demand streaming, called Dynamic Buffering. The proposed Dynamic Buffering relies on the feature of MDC to gradually reduce the number of cached descriptions held in a client's buffers, once the buffer is full. Preserving as many initial parts of descriptions in the buffer as possible, instead of losing them all at one time, effectively extends peers’ service time. In addition, this study proposes a description distribution balancing scheme to further improve the use of resources. Simulation experiments show that Dynamic Buffering can make efficient use of cache space, reduce server bandwidth consumption, and increase the number of peers being served.

H.263을 기반으로하는 인터넷용 동영상 서비스 시스템 구현 (Implementation of a video service system for internet based on H.263)

  • 이성수;남재열
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 1998년도 하계종합학술대회논문집
    • /
    • pp.737-740
    • /
    • 1998
  • Under the worldwide booming internet environment, there has been increasing demand for various multimedia services. Especially the demand for effective video services has been rapidly increased. In this paper, we describe the implementation of video service system for internet use based on H/263 video compression technique and UDP socket on the TCP/IP environment. In addition, by using the plug-in-play technique, the implemented system improved user interface for correct retrieval and easy usage.

  • PDF

Effective Broadcasting and Caching Technique for Video on Demand over Wireless Network

  • Alomari, Saleh Ali;Sumari, Putra
    • KSII Transactions on Internet and Information Systems (TIIS)
    • /
    • 제6권3호
    • /
    • pp.919-940
    • /
    • 2012
  • Video on Demand (VOD) is a multimedia service which allows a remote user to select and then view video at his convenience at any time he wants, which makes the VOD become an important technology for many applications. Numerous periodic VOD broadcasting protocols have been proposed to support a large number of receivers. Broadcasting is an efficient transmission scheme to provide on-demand service for very popular movies. This paper proposes a new broadcasting scheme called Popularity Cushion Staggered Broadcasting (PCSB). The proposed scheme improves the Periodic Broadcasting (PB) protocols in the latest mobile VOD system, which is called MobiVoD system. It also, reduces the maximum waiting time of the mobile node, by partitioning the $1^{st}$ segment of the whole video and storing it in the Local Media Forwarder (LMF) exactly in the Pool of RAM (PoR), and then transmitting them when the mobile nodes miss the $1^{st}$ broadcasted segment. The results show that the PCSB is more efficient and better than the all types of broadcasting and caching techniques in the MobiVoD system. Furthermore, these results exhibits that system performance is stable under high dynamics of the system and the viewer's waiting time are less than the previous system.

주문형 비디오 서비스 시스템에서 VCR 기능을 위한 Batching 전송 (Batching delivery for VCR-like functions in video-on-demand service system)

  • 박호균;유황빈
    • 한국통신학회논문지
    • /
    • 제22권12호
    • /
    • pp.2852-2859
    • /
    • 1997
  • 주문형 비디오(Video-On-Demand) 시스템은 광대역 통신 네트워크를 통하여 사용자가 원하는 영화를 융통성있게 제공하는 전자 비디오 대여 시스템이다. 대부분의 제안된 VOD 시스템은 사용자와 비디오 서버 간에 일대일 연결로 설계되어 있어 하나의 비디오 서버 스트림을 전용 전송 채널로 각 사용자에게 개별적으로 서비스되었다. 그러나 동일한 비디오 스트림을 엑세스하는 다수의 사용자에게 개별적으로 전용 전송 채널로 서비스를 하는 것은 매우 비효율적이며 비용의 낭비를 초래한다. 따라서, 비용 효율성을 얻기 위하여, 동일한 비디오 스트림을 요구하는 다수의 사용자에게 멀티캐스트 기능을 이용하여 하나의 스트림으로 전송하는 batching 기법이 연구되었다. 그러나, batching에 의한 멀티캐스트의 사용은 오히려 VCR 기능의 특성과 on-demand 특성을 저하시키는 단점을 가지고 있다. 본 논문에서는 서버에 대한 I/O와 네트워크 대역폭을 감소시키기 위하여 가입자 인접 부근인 엑세스 노드에 가변 playout point를 갖는 동적 버퍼를 두어 동일한 비디오 스트림을 요구하는 사용자들을 batching으로 전송하는 기법을 제안하였다. 따라서, 사용자당 비디오 전송 비용을 감소시켰으며, 사용자들이 true VOD를 사용하는 것과 마찬가지로 대화형 VCR 명령을 가능하게 하였다. 또한, 초기 요구나 VCR 기능이 수행된 후에도 어떠한 batching지연이 없이 바로 멀티캐스트 비디오 스트림을 전송할 수 있었으며, 소수의 서버 용량으로 많은 사용자들에게 서비스하여 시스템의 성능을 향상시킬 수 있었다.

  • PDF

웹 기반 VOD 시스템을 위한 익명성이 제공되는 Pay-Per-View 서비스 (Anonymous Pay-Per-View Service for Web-Based Video-on-Demand Systems)

  • 주한규
    • 디지털콘텐츠학회 논문지
    • /
    • 제9권1호
    • /
    • pp.69-75
    • /
    • 2008
  • VOD (Video-on-Demand) 서비스는 사용자가 원하는 비디오를 언제든지 볼 수 있도록 해 준다. 고속의 컴퓨터 네트워크의 발달로 웹 기반 VOD 서비스가 가능하게 되었다. VOD 서비스를 지원하기 위해서는 요금 부과 기법이 필요하다. VOD 요금 부과 기법으로 사용자가 시청한 분량에 따라 요금을 부과하는 pay-per-view를 생각할 수 있다. VOD에서 사용자의 사생활 보호 또한 중요한 이슈가 된다. 사용자는 자신의 시청 정보를 타인에게 노출시키고 싶지 않을 것이다. 이를 위해서 VOD 서비스에 익명성을 제공할 필요가 있다. 익명성 제공은 VOD 서비스 요금 계산을 복잡하게 한다. 익명성 제공과 요금 계산을 함께 지원하는 VOD 기법이 필요하다. 이 논문에서는 익명성이 제공되는 웹 기반 VOD 서비스가 제안된다. 제안된 기법은 사용자의 시청 분량에 따라 요금을 부과하는 pay-per-view 기능을 지원한다.

  • PDF

멀티미디어 스트리밍 서버를 위한 인기도 기반 인터벌 캐슁의 블록 수준 세분화 기법 (Block Level Refinement of Popularity-Aware Interval Caching for Multimedia Streaming Servers)

  • 권오훈;김태석;반효경;고건
    • 한국정보과학회논문지:시스템및이론
    • /
    • 제34권4호
    • /
    • pp.138-144
    • /
    • 2007
  • 최근 VOD(Video-On-Demand) 서비스가 널리 이용되면서 멀티미디어 스트리밍 서버를 위한 데이타 캐슁 기법의 중요성이 점점 증가하고 있다. 기존 연구를 통해 인터벌 캐슁 기법과 이를 객체의 인기도를 반영하도록 확장한 기법들이 다양한 환경에서 우수한 성능을 나타냄이 입증되었다. 본 논문에서는 이와 같은 기존의 기법을 블록 수준으로 세분화할 경우 멀티미디어 스트리밍 서버의 성능을 더욱 향상 시킬 수 있음을 보인다. 실제 VOD 서버의 트레이스를 이용한 시뮬레이션 실험을 통해 본 논문이 제안한 알고리즘이 캐쉬 적중률과 스트림의 초기 지연 시간을 향상시킴을 보인다.

실시간 화상 한국어 교육과정 개발을 위한 기초 연구 -사이버 대학교에 재학 중인 여성결혼이민자를 중심으로- (A basic study to develop Realtime video Korean curriculum: Focusing on female-marriage immigrants in Cyber University)

  • 최은지;한하림;서정민
    • 한국어교육
    • /
    • 제29권2호
    • /
    • pp.181-208
    • /
    • 2018
  • The aim of this study is to design a Real-time video Korean curriculum. Curriculum using real-time video, which is a variant of distance learning, teaches Korean to students studying in distant places through real-time video communication program. This is expected to supplement the lack of interaction in existing video classes and enable online simultaneous interaction, while increasing learning opportunities for Korean language students living in distance places. To find out the needs of the subjects for the curriculum design, this study conducted a one-on-one interview with 9 female married immigrants who are enrolled in the Cyber University which is opening a curriculum later. According to the survey, the students answered that they have a high intention of attending classes if the lack of interaction in existing distance classes are supplemented. Therefore, we could confirm the demand of a curriculum consisting of an overall real-time video education and multilateral individual connection. Also, we found out that there is a demand in performance rather than comprehension and a high demand for detailed feedback from the teacher. The result shows that the curriculum needs to establish performance-oriented contents to progress to an advanced level Korean Language, and include a study plain comprising of real-time interaction.

인터넷상에서의 실시간 주문형 비디오 설계 및 구현 (A Design and Iplementation of Real Time Video on Demand on Internet)

  • 이종철;탁영봉
    • 대한전자공학회:학술대회논문집
    • /
    • 대한전자공학회 1998년도 추계종합학술대회 논문집
    • /
    • pp.7-10
    • /
    • 1998
  • In implementing real time video on demand(VOD), the increase of user on internet causes a network traffic congestion. In this paper, we programmed a CGI able to login in VOD home for limiting the number of user in solving the problem, and also applied and adaptive multimedia synchronization technique for controlling video and audio data in a network. In addition, a real time multimedia player was designed and implemented in a personal computer operating at Window95/98/NT.

  • PDF